Pike Fishing Tackle
There are many things an angler should include in his Northern pike fishing tackle box. Some are crucial necessities; others are nice to have so you are covered for every season and location. The following paragraphs will go over all the accoutrements you will want to consider having so your tackle box is well-equipped.
Probably the most important items you must have for Northern pike fishing are leaders. While perch and bass fishing do not require the use of leaders, they are imperative if you hope to hook and reel in a Northern. These mighty fish have razor-sharp teeth that can easily bite through regular fishing line. Leaders are metal wires that provide reinforcement on your line so your lunkers won’t get away so easily. Bite leaders are the type of leaders you will want in your Northern pike tackle box. A length of 6-24 inches will be sufficient.
There are many types of Northern pike lures you can use to catch these large and usually hungry fish. The nice thing about pike fishing is that since they will eat virtually anything, you can use a wide variety of lures to suit your fancy. However, some lures are more popular and effective than others. Spoons are great for trolling; you might want to have some weedless spoons on hand if you will be trolling in the weeds. Brightly colored spoons are a great choice, particularly the Eppinger Dardevle. These spoons will appear to look like baitfish scales in the water, so they are visually appealing to Northerns. Spoons are also effective because they wobble in the water, and that movement is an attractant. Spinnerbaits and plugs (crankbaits in particular) are other good lures to use if you want to use movement to attract a fish. Surface lures, such as buzzbaits and stickbaits, are nice to have around when fish are most active in the warm months of the year. For colder weather when pike are less active, jigs can be useful since they are used slowly.
Other must-haves for any fisherman’s pike fishing tackle box are a net and needle-nosed pliers. A net will help you bring in a feisty fish as you are reeling in your line. Many times a Northern will swallow your hook, so the pliers will help you try to salvage it.
As long as you are equipped with some leaders, a net, pliers, and some appropriate lures for the season, you will have a great start to your Northern pike fishing tackle collection. Then, build up your collection of lures as the seasons and environment dictate.
